"Things Just Get Away From You" is the 216 page, hardcover collection of my work, published by Fantagraphics Books. You can buy a copy directly from Fantagraphics by clicking on the cover image below. The book is also available through Amazon.

fantagraphics


"Holcombe is largely to blame for enticing me to the medium. His work is a cartoon Trojan horse that lures the reader with bouncing whimsical brush lines and then unleashes the most lonely and brutal sentiments. Musical, poetic, and ornamental, a blend of Victorian novels and Dr. Seuss."

                                                                                  - Craig Thompson


"Walt Holcombe is a true original: his jazzy drawings and mellifluous prose (to say nothing of his partiality for pathetic nebbishes, marine adventures, and 'the exotic') concoct a personal, perfectly-timed viand redolent of 1920's humorists, Cliff Sterrett, and more than anything, of Walt himself. I should also add that a big-hearted compassion backs his work like a stretched canvas behind paint."

                                                                                  - Chris Ware
